As a d-man, your heart just breaks for the guy.

I don't know what it is about d-men and clearing it up the middle. It's one of the very first things you learn about playing it in your own zone: Don't clear it up the middle.

But guess what? We ALWAYS think we can. And guess what? The ONE time we think we can do it safely, it bites us in the butt.

Clear it up the boards, kids. Every time.
